It can exert a greater force through a ... WebHow to visualize the torque equation. A wrench produces a torque on a nut if a force is applied to it correctly (see Figure 1). The equation for torque is: \tau = rF\sin\theta τ = rF sinθ. Figure 1. Variables of the torque equation shown for a wrench and nut. WebIn physics, action at a distance is the concept that an object can be affected without being physically touched (as in mechanical contact) by another object.That is, it is the non-local interaction of objects that are separated in space. Fields extend through space and can be mapped … flowers by fletcher hawaiiWebA force is a push or a pull. When the wind pushes a sailing boat through the water, it is exerting a force. When gravity pulls an apple towards the ground, that is a force as well. Forces can make things move, change their speed, or change their shape. Some forces act when two things touch, for example when a person kicks a football.
